1. Ignoring the Quality 

One of the biggest mistakes that buyers make when importing granite is ignoring the quality of the stone. Checking the quality of the stone is one of the most essential things that you can do to save yourself from significant losses.

What you need to check:

  • Check for surface cracks or micro-fissures
  • Uneven polishing or poor finishing
  • Composition, durability, and colour
  • Hidden defects
  • Always make sure to take samples and check reviews

3. Ignoring Supplier Verification

Many buyers ignore verifying the supplier when they get a favourable price. One of the most important things that you need to do is to verify the vendor for the first time, which reduces all the delays, fraud or losses.

What buyers need to check:

  • Supplier certifications and export experience
  • Production capacity
  • The infrastructure of the vendor
  • Customer reviews
  • Past projects

5. Ignoring Packaging

Granite packaging is one of the most important things when it comes to importing. Many buyers face losses due to damages occured during transit because of weak packaging. This is why you need to make sure that the packaging is tough so that a heavy yet fragile stone like granite stays safe.

Common packaging mistakes you need to watch for: 

  • Weak wooden crates
  • Lack of cushioning materials
  • Improper slab stacking
  • Make sure that the granite is packed strong otherwise, do not accept it

6. Ignoring Shipping Costs

Many buyers underestimate the cost factors that affect granite exporting and importing prices. Buyers need to understand how shipping granite can cost a lot, and they need to prepare themselves for various charges, such as freight, customs duties, port handling fees, and more, that can impact their budget.

Here are some hidden costs that buyers should know:

  • Ocean freight fluctuation charges
  • Import duties and taxes
  • Port charges due to delays
  • Always plan your logistics and decide on a price in advance with reliable granite exporters.

8. Ignoring Compliance and Documentation

Importing granite can be a hefty task that involves various legal requirements. This is exactly why it is suggested for everyone to carry proper documentation and make sure that your shipment aligns with the country’s policies to prevent delays or penalties.

Your documents will be: 

  • Commercial invoice
  • Packing list
  • Certificate of origin
  • Bill of lading
  • Ensure all of the paperwork is accurate
  • Make sure your shipment aligns with the port’s regulations
